First Time With Santa


For Jellybean's first Santa picture, I just knew it had to be something special. None of this fake beard the Santa is really only 35 years old business. I want real beard, twinkle in his eye, old man is dressing up because he loves kids and looks forward to doing this every year kind of Santa. So I spent a morning Googling best Santas in the area and everyone pointed to Bass Pro Shop of all places. Who am I to disagree or question more experienced moms? 

The day I chose to take Jellybean to Santa, I put him in a "Santa's Little Helper" shirt and red and white striped pants. It would be the perfect outfit for his first trip to see the old man he wouldn't even remember or know the significance of. My little man had other plans though. That day they painted at daycare and while he normally wears a smock and is very good with paint...this time around he got it EVERYWHERE. It was in his hair, ears, and all over his themed outfit. I neglected to tell the daycare we were getting pictures taken that night. Fortunately, since it's currently FREEZING in Virginia, I took him to daycare in his polar bear outfit. That would serve as a good substitute to the red and white outfit I had picked out that morning. 

Bass Pro Shops goes ALL OUT for Christmas. At least my local one did. They had an entire Christmas village set up. Complete with mini carousel, toy monster tucks in a dirt pit, a huge race car track, ducks you could shoot with toy guns, bow and rubber arrow stand, a talking reindeer....it was AWESOME. And the best part? At 1800 on a Monday night, it wasn't crowded and there wasn't a long line of screaming impatient children to sit through. When I got there, Jellybean was knocked out in his car seat. I wasn't about to wake a sleeping baby and risk a screaming baby Santa picture. I'm sure I'll have one later down the road but for his first picture ever....I was determined to make sure it was perfect! We walked around the store, played some games (even though they were for the kiddos) and waited patiently for my little man to wake up from his nap. 

When it came time for the pic, I worried a little that a stranger in a red suit and white fluffy beard might scare the guy. But he's never had stranger anxiety and is a pretty chill little dude. A few silly faces from dad instigated a little smirk out of my man and with the click of the camera, we got our perfect first Santa picture! I seriously couldn't be any happier.
